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is the "Automotive high pressure pump solenoid valve with limp home calibration." This invention features a module solenoid valve that includes a valve body defining an inlet and an outlet opening. The valve body is equipped with a valve seat at its distal end, and a valve member controls the flow of fuel through the outlet opening. The design incorporates a movable armature coupled with the valve member, allowing for precise control of the valve's open and closed positions. An electromagnetic coil is associated with the armature to facilitate its movement, while a spring biases the armature to maintain the valve in a closed position.
Another notable patent is the "Inlet orifice for a fuel pressure damper." This invention consists of a fuel pressure damper housing that defines an inlet for receiving fuel. An orifice disc is positioned at the inlet, featuring at least one orifice. The design includes a flexible diaphragm that is secured to the housing or cover, allowing for effective dampening of fuel pressure pulsations. The orifice is specifically constructed to prevent damaging pressure pulsations from entering the damper.
